Output ef2d76905ab22455ea62bf908954f2771c76874eb2d7d4fa9ee6fd0f78150807:2

value
116167
script pubkey
OP_0 OP_PUSHBYTES_20 22f00e1e6f3c0f0e57d2af59b04fcd5a92a11c5e
address
tb1qytcqu8n08s8su47j4avmqn7dt2f2z8z7gtjny6
transaction
ef2d76905ab22455ea62bf908954f2771c76874eb2d7d4fa9ee6fd0f78150807
confirmations
81758
spent
true